My Background and Approach

My background includes working with children, neurodiverse adults, and adult children of low-capacity/relationally-unskilled parents with a unique focus on gender norms and intergenerational/immigrant family dynamics. My approach to healing is that it happens when we feel safe, secure, and supported. Through a relational lens, I work to create a space where all of who you are is met with compassion, respect, and understanding. Together we explore your inner world, your relationships, and the broader systems that have shaped you to create space for real, sustainable change.
